Active Involvement

Excellent

Student is constantly engaged in the class activity. Student does not need reminders to stay on task.
Above Average

Student is often engaged in the activities. Student could participate more in class activity, but is never causing a distraction.
Average

Student is often engaged in the activity. Student needs a reminder to get back on task and can be distracting to teacher and classmates.
Poor

Student is not involved with the class activity. Student needs constant reminders to get back on task. Student is distracting to the class as a whole.
Extremely Poor

Preparation

Excellent

Student is ready with required materials for the class. Begins work before the bell rings.
Above Average

Student is usually ready with required materials for the class. Begins work when the bell rings.
Average

Student often has some materials. Students begin work after late bell rings.
Poor

Student did not bring any materials to class and has to borrow everything. Student does not begin work.
Extremely Poor
